Elegant loft in Tiffany & Co.’s old Union Square HQ seeks $5.3M

The two-bedroom apartment is truly one-of-a-kind

It's been a while since we've checked in at 15 Union Square West, the former HQ of Tiffany & Company that was converted to a glass-box luxury condo nearly 10 years ago. Recently, a two-bedroom condo in the building hit the market, and while the brokerbabble is a bit over-the-top—"extraordinarily sophisticated" and "monumental achievement" both appear in the listing—it's certainly a unique and, yes, lovely space.

The two-bedroom duplex got a makeover by famed designer Vicente Wolf, who combined classic elegance with sleek, contemporary details. Spread across nearly 2,300 square feet, the condo consists of a grand living room with 16-foot ceilings and arched floor-to-ceiling windows, a sculptural stainless steel and glass staircase, a marble-dressed chef’s kitchen, and an elegant powder room adorned with mahogany and more marble.

The bathrooms are no less chic. Within one of the two-and-a-half bathrooms is a regal claw-foot tub surrounded by stone walls, modern double vanities, and a separate free-standing shower. There are at least two large walk-in closets and a couple of smaller storage spaces, and a washer/dryer unit.

The price for all of this: $5.3 million, which is a pretty big dip from summer 2015, when it first appeared for $6.9 million.
